skip to main  |
      skip to sidebar
          
        
          
        
Cummins hiring BE/BTech / BSc / BCA / ME/MTech / MCA graduates as Software Engineer
JOB DESCRIPTION
Job Title : Computer Software Engineer
Job ID : 140000IP
Job : ENGINEERING
Primary Location : India-Maharashtra-Pune-India, Pune, Down Town Centre
Job Type : Experienced - Professional / Office
Qualification Details :
BE/BTech/BSc/BCA/ME/MTech/MCA in Computer Science or related field
JOB SUMMARY
- Develops and maintains Electronic/Software Tools and reusable software components in support of world-wide Cummins and delivery partner engineering, manufacturing, and service operations for electronic products across all business units. 
- Electronic Tool products include software components, utilities, applications and software systems. 
- Electronic products include generator sets, engines, components, business systems and other systems.
Responsibilities :
- Position typically is responsible for one or two software product at a given time. Support responsibilities include software design and coding, verification and validation, tool product release, and customer support. Provides customer support (Tier3) as required to minimize downtime for tool users.
- Complies with tool software development processes and work flows for nominal work items; and supports work flow improvements projects.
- Demonstrates user skills in most areas listed in the Skills/Competencies section
- Position is strictly an individual contributor with respect to formal Cummins performance management activities. Position may require to lead project work and/or direct the work of suppliers in support of project work.
Skills / Competencies
- Windows Programming Languages - C++, C#, JAVA
- Operating systems – Windows
- Database systems and concepts - Microsoft Access, Oracle
- Network protocols - HTTP, SFTP
- Computing Fundamentals
- Software product engineering and software life cycle
- Software systems architecture practices, methods and tools
- Software unit testing, integration testing, and system testing practices, methods and tools
- Software configuration management practices, methods and tools
- Must have good verbal, written and interpersonal communication skills
- Ability to effectively work as part of a global team
- Ability to organize and prioritize multiple tasks to meet deadlines
- Strong problem solving and troubleshooting abilities
- Self-motivated and able to perform with minimal supervision
Prefered :
- Software Installation Packaging e.g Flexera Installshield
- Project management practices, methods and tools
Optional :
- Human factor design
- Agile programming experience